The primary difference between a device labeled an “analyzer” and one labeled a “monitor” is that a monitor includes adjustable low, or low and high alarm settings. Although the terms, Gas monitors can measure either a single gas or multiple gases and are grouped into two general classifications: mainstream and sidestream. Anesthetic gas analyzers measure the concentration of the volatile anesthetic, oxygen, N 2 O, and CO 2 in inspired and expired gas.
